Natural rubber is a linear polymer of isoprene (2-methyl-1,3-butadiene). The isoprene unit is the basic building block (monomer) of the polymer chain.

The IUPAC name for isoprene is 2-methylbuta-1,3-diene.
It consists of a four-carbon chain with double bonds at the first and third positions and a methyl group branching from the second carbon.

In natural rubber, these units are linked in a cis-1,4 configuration, which gives rubber its elastic properties.
